Heliotropium arborescens L. - syn.Heliotropium peruvianum L. - Boraginaceae
(garden) heliotrope, cherry pie, Heliotrop, Vanilleblume, (Strauchige) Sonnenwende

Fragrant evergeen shrub, native to the peruvian Andes. Commonly cultivated as annual herb, sometimes with variegated color of the leaves (violet-green or golden) or flowers (white).

„Flavors of heliotrope flowers were analyzed by Solid Phase Microextraction Method (SPME) equipped with GC-MS. The major volatiles identified were benzaldehyde, benzyl acetate and p-anisaldehyde.“
[Flavors of Heliotrope Flowers, Analyzed by Solid Phase Microextraction Method. Hisano H, Ishimaru K, Tada H, Ikeda Y. Japanese Journal of Food Chemistry 2 (1), 6-8, 1995-10-01]

„The majority of the volatile compounds emanating from the flowers were terpenes (camphene, p-cymene, δ-3-carene, α-humulene, δ-1-limonene, linalool, (E)-β-ocimene, α-pinene, and β-thujone), benzenoids of which benzaldehyde was the most abundant, aldehydes (decanal, heptanal, nonanal and octanal), and hydrocarbons decane, heneicosane, heptadecane, hexadecane, nonadecane, nonane, octadecane, tetradecane, tridecane and undecane) along with a cross-section of other compounds.“
[Volatile Floral Chemistry of Heliotropium arborescens L. ‘Marine’. Stanley J. Kays, Jason Hatch, and Dong Sik Yang, Hort Science 40(5):1237–1238. 2005]
